Default Scion XB 2010 Engine Rebuild Kit

Hello all!
Which one of these engine rebuild kits is correct and the best one for a 2010 scion XB that will fix the issue with the piston ring defect and oil consumption? I don't know if I'm going to do this, but I have a guy that might be able to for a decent labor price.

The last three will work for it but you really need to open the engine up first to see what needs replacing. Bare minimum for the repair is the pistons and rings as they had the design flaw. Past that it depends on what, if anything, else has worn due to the problem. If the bearings spun you may need more than all of these kits have as you might need to replace the crankshaft, or get it machined. If you need to machine any of the bearing surfaces then the generic bearing supplied in these kits probably won't work as you'll need thicker ones to take up the extra space from the machining. Basically open up the engine first then you can figure out what you need.
